Arvinas (NASDAQ:ARVN) CEO Randy Teel Sells 2,209 Shares

Key Points

  • CEO Randy Teel sold 2,209 shares of Arvinas stock on May 21 at an average price of $9.04, for proceeds of about $19,969. The filing says the sale was made to cover tax withholding tied to vesting equity awards.
  • Teel has been active in selling shares recently, including another 9,657-share sale on May 11 and 4,786 shares on Feb. 23.
  • Arvinas reported a smaller-than-expected quarterly loss, posting EPS of -$0.90 versus estimates of -$0.95, but revenue fell 91.7% year over year and the company remains unprofitable. Analysts currently have a consensus Hold rating with a $14.69 average price target.

Arvinas, Inc. (NASDAQ:ARVN - Get Free Report) CEO Randy Teel sold 2,209 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, May 21st. The stock was sold at an average price of $9.04, for a total transaction of $19,969.36.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er owned 285,009 shares in the company, valued at approximately $2,576,481.36. This trade represents a 0.77%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available at the SEC website. The sale was made to cover tax withholding obligations related to the vesting of equity awards.

Randy Teel also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Monday, May 11th, Randy Teel sold 9,657 shares of Arvinas st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$9.94, for a total transaction of $95,990.58.
  • On Monday, February 23rd, Randy Teel sold 4,786 shares of Arvinas st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$12.16, for a total transaction of $58,197.76.

Arvinas Trading Down 0.1%

Shares of ARVN opened at $9.09 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$586.49 million, a PE ratio of -2.74 and a beta of 1.79. The company's 50 day simple moving average is $10.50 and its 200-day simple moving average is $11.64. Arvinas, Inc. has a 12-month low of $6.05 and a 12-month high of $14.51.




Arvinas (NASDAQ:ARVN -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, May 12th. The company reported ($0.90)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.95) by $0.05. The business had revenue of $15.60 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$16.61 million. Arvinas had a negative net margin of 247.54% and a negative return on equity of 44.38%. The company's revenue for the quarter was down 91.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the firm posted $1.14 earnings per share. As a group, equities research analysts forecast that Arvinas, Inc. will post -2.85 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Arvinas

(Get Free Report)

Arvinas, Inc (NASDAQ: ARVN) is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of therapies based on targeted protein degradation. Utilizing its proprietary proteolysis-targeting chimera (PROTAC®) platform, Arvinas aims to selectively eliminate disease-causing proteins rather than merely inhibit their activity. This novel approach has the potential to address a range of diseases, including oncology, neurodegeneration and inflammation, by harnessing the body's natural protein-recycling systems.

The company's most advanced clinical candidates address hormone-driven cancers.
